Passenger Expectations from Cabin Crew

Air travel is an experience that goes far beyond reaching a destination. The journey itself, especially the interaction with cabin crew, can leave a lasting impression on passengers. For many travelers, the cabin crew represents the airline during the flight. Their professionalism, care, and attentiveness directly shape how passengers feel about the trip.

Warmth and Approachability

One of the first things passengers notice is the behavior of the cabin crew. Travelers expect crew members to be approachable and friendly. A warm smile, polite greetings, and genuine care can immediately put passengers at ease. This is especially important for first-time flyers or individuals who feel anxious about flying. Friendly interactions create a sense of comfort and trust, making the journey enjoyable right from the start.

Clear and Effective Communication

Communication is vital in ensuring a smooth flight experience. Passengers rely on cabin crew for instructions, updates, and assistance. Clear announcements about safety procedures, boarding, and flight conditions help passengers feel informed and confident. Crew members who can explain processes patiently, answer questions politely, and provide guidance during delays or turbulence meet one of the core expectations of passengers.

Safety and Preparedness

Safety remains the top priority in aviation. Passengers expect cabin crew to be vigilant and prepared for any situation. From pre-flight safety demonstrations to managing in-flight emergencies, crew members are trusted to maintain a secure environment. Displaying confidence, knowledge, and composure reassures passengers that their wellbeing is in capable hands. Even routine checks, like seatbelt fastening or monitoring cabin conditions, contribute to a sense of security and professionalism.

Prompt and Attentive Service

Passengers expect attentive service throughout the flight. This includes timely meal and beverage delivery, quick responses to requests, and proactive assistance when needed. Observing passenger needs, such as offering blankets, helping with luggage, or addressing special requirements, demonstrates care and attentiveness. A crew member who notices and acts without being asked often leaves a positive impression that passengers remember long after landing.

Empathy and Understanding

Empathy plays a key role in passenger satisfaction. Each traveller has unique needs, whether it’s a nervous flyer, a family traveling with children, or someone with medical requirements. Cabin crew who recognize these individual situations and respond with patience and understanding make the flight comfortable for everyone. Simple gestures, like offering reassurance during turbulence or helping with seating arrangements, reflect a thoughtful approach that passengers value deeply.

Professionalism and Composure

Professionalism extends to appearance, behavior, and attitude. Passengers expect cabin crew to maintain a polished, calm, and courteous presence throughout the journey. Even in challenging situations, such as handling complaints or managing delays, crew members are expected to remain composed and solution-oriented. This professionalism builds confidence in passengers and enhances the reputation of the airline.

Personalization and Human Connection

Many passengers appreciate a personal touch. Remembering names, acknowledging frequent flyers, or showing genuine interest in passenger comfort creates a connection that goes beyond standard service. These small but meaningful interactions make passengers feel recognized and valued. The ability to combine efficiency with a human touch distinguishes great cabin crew from average service providers.

Balancing Efficiency and Care

Passengers expect cabin crew to manage the balance between efficiency and care. While timely service is crucial for smooth operations, it should never feel rushed or impersonal. Crew members who can maintain pace without compromising courtesy or attention meet passenger expectations effectively. This balance ensures that flights run on schedule while passengers feel attended to and respected.
